Everytime I save the bricks, close the server, open it again later, then load the bricks, the ownerships of the bricks have screwed up. Completely random bricks that are owned by others end up with my ownership, but the rest of their bricks are perfectly fine. My bricks that I made are still fine. When I save the bricks, it is checked to save the owners, and same for when I load the bricks. This has been extremely annoying because everyone can't build half of their builds without my trust.

When saving or loading a build, the brick's ownership is determined by the ownership of the baseplate it's on. Only baseplates save ownership - and by that I mean the brick supporting the rest of the bricks.

When saving or loading a build, the brick's ownership is determined by the ownership of the baseplate it's on. Only baseplates save ownership - and by that I mean the brick supporting the rest of the bricks.
